Heat Can Do More to Promote Soccer

Regarding Paul McLeod’s article on the Los Angeles Heat (Friday, July 13), it is true that the team is understaffed and perhaps low on funds. But there are a number of things that a dedicated staff (no matter how small) could do with little expenditure to increase attendance and awareness of the team and sport of soccer:

* Someone with the Heat has to write something about the team every day and send it to local papers.

* The Heat should contact every youth soccer program and coach in Southern California and offer deals to get them to bring their players to the games.

* There should be a public-address announcer with enthusiasm.

* The Heat should sponsor a booster club.

* The team should advertise local players in its lineup.

* Dedication. I don’t believe the present employees in the Heat office are dedicated.

THOMAS E. MILITELLO, MD

Palos Verdes Peninsula
